topshape solid-square solid-square solid-square solid-square solid-square solid-square solid-square solid-square solid-square solid-square solid-square

                      开发基于以太坊的冷钱包:保护您的数字资产安

                      • 2024-12-07 03:38:34

                          在数字货币日益普及的今天,如何安全地存储和管理资产已经成为一个重要话题。在众多区块链平台中,以太坊(Ethereum)因其智能合约和DApp(去中心化应用)的广泛应用而受到关注。然而,随着以太坊资产量的增加,如何保护这些资产的安全性,尤其是采用冷钱包的方式,也逐渐引起了投资者的重视。

                          冷钱包是一种不与互联网直接连接的钱包,其核心目的在于提供更高层次的安全性。与热钱包相比,冷钱包能有效防止黑客攻击和潜在的网络安全威胁,因而被越来越多的用户采用。本文将深入探讨如何开发基于以太坊的冷钱包,涉及设计思路、技术细节和市场前景等方面。

                          一、冷钱包的概念与意义

                          冷钱包的最基本定义是:一种不连接到互联网或网络的加密货币钱包。这种钱包可以以硬件设备、纸质钱包或其他形式存在,设计初衷是为了最大限度地保护用户的私钥和数字资产。

                          冷钱包的意义在于其依然能够保证用户的资产安全,尤其是在黑客攻击频繁的环境下,提供了更为可靠的保护手段。用户不再需要担心热钱包所面临的各种网络风险,包括但不限于网络钓鱼、黑客入侵等。通过将资产冷藏在冷钱包中,公司或个人能够有效地管理他们的资产,提升安全性。

                          二、开发基于以太坊的冷钱包的设计思路

                          开发以太坊冷钱包的过程需要从多个方面考虑,涉及到用户体验、界面设计、安全架构等多个方面。以下是一些关键的设计思路。

                          • 用户界面友好性: 冷钱包应当具备简洁直观的用户界面,使得用户可以轻松进行操作,比如生成新钱包、导入助记词、转账等。设计要注重视觉体验,减轻用户的学习曲线。
                          • 安全性: 冷钱包的高安全性是其最大卖点。在开发过程中,通过多重签名、硬件加密和其他防护机制来保护用户的私钥。同时,用户的数据也应加密存储,不应以明文形式保存。
                          • 备份与恢复功能: 任何钱包都需要强大的备份和恢复机制。用户应能够通过助记词或私钥进行恢复,确保在设备丢失的情况下仍能找回资产。

                          三、技术实现细节

                          在技术实现方面,开发基于以太坊的冷钱包需要考虑多种技术栈。以下是一些主要的实现细节:

                          • 智能合约支持: 利用以太坊的智能合约功能,用户可以设计一些特定的合约,进行自动化管理资产。例如,设定资产锁定期限、特定转账条件等。开发者需确保合约代码经过充分审计,确保没有安全漏洞。
                          • 硬件钱包集成: 为了进一步提升安全性,可以考虑与现有的硬件钱包产品进行集成。硬件钱包如Ledger和Trezor已经在市场上取得了良好的口碑,可通过API或SDK进行配合。
                          • 离线签名功能: 冷钱包的关键是离线签名功能,即能够在不连接互联网的情况下,进行签名以完成交易。这可以通过生成交易后将其转移到有网络环境的设备上进行签名。

                          四、市场前景与机遇

                          随着区块链技术的逐步成熟,数字资产市场的吸引力不断增加,冷钱包的需求也在急剧增长。越来越多的个人和企业认识到数字资产的投资价值,冷钱包应运而生,成为最佳选择。

                          在市场前景方面,投资者对数字资产安全的要求日益增强,冷钱包的市场需求将持续上升。同时,随着监管政策的完善,用户对合规、安全的钱包服务需求也会增加,推动冷钱包产品的不断迭代和更新。

                          总结来说,通过深入理解开发基于以太坊的冷钱包的各个方面,能够更好地保护用户的数字资产安全,为广大的数字货币投资者提供更为可靠的存储解决方案。

                          常见问题解答

                          1. 冷钱包与热钱包的区别是什么?

                          冷钱包与热钱包的区别主要体现在连接互联网的方式。热钱包是指始终在线的钱包,用户可以随时进行交易和转账,但由于其与互联网的连接,安全性相对较低,易受到黑客攻击。反之,冷钱包未连接互联网,安全性更高。

                          冷钱包通常以硬件设备或纸质形式存在,确保用户的私钥不会暴露在网络上。虽然冷钱包在使用上可能没有热钱包方便,但它能在安全方面提供显著优势。因此,冷钱包更适合长期持有资产的用户,而热钱包更适合进行频繁交易的用户。

                          2. 如何选择合适的冷钱包?

                          在选择冷钱包时,用户需要考虑多个因素,包括安全性、使用方便性、兼容性和价格等。

                          首先,安全性是选择冷钱包的首要因素。在选择前,用户应调查冷钱包制造商的信用和历史记录,确保其具备良好的口碑。其次,使用方便性也不可忽视,一个操作简便的冷钱包能够节省用户的时间,提高体验。

                          此外,兼容性非常重要,用户应选择支持以太坊及其代币的钱包,同时确认是否能与其他设备和应用兼容。最后,价格也是考虑因素之一,用户应根据自己的预算选择合适的产品。总之,综合考虑以上因素才能选择到最适合的冷钱包。

                          3. 使用冷钱包安全性如何?

                          使用冷钱包的安全性相对较高,但用户仍需注意一些问题。首先,用户需要确保冷钱包的来源和真伪,避免购买到假冒产品。其次,冷钱包在使用时,用户应合理管理私钥和助记词,确保它们不被他人知晓。

                          此外,用户需定期检查冷钱包的安全性,保持软件版本更新,防止潜在的漏洞。通过定期备份和维护,用户能够有效提升资产的安全性,真正做到对数字资产的保护。

                          4. 数字资产的安全性应如何提升?

                          提升数字资产的安全性是一个多方位的问题。首先,用户应使用冷钱包进行资产的长期存储,避免将所有资产存放在热钱包中。其次,用户应设置强密码,尽量避免使用简单易被破解的密码。此外,启用双重认证也是提升安全性的有效手段。

                          最后,用户还需关注最新的安全动态,了解黑客攻击的常见手法,以提高自己的安全意识,做到未雨绸缪,保障数字资产的安全。综上所述,对数字资产的深入了解和合理的安全措施操作是防范风险的关键。

                          • Tags
                          • 以太坊,冷钱包,数字资产安全